I own one of these horns and I use it when I really need a small F tuba type sound. The horn is great for playing 2nd trombone music in quartets. I had a 5th valve installed on mine and for the total cost, it is a pretty hard horn to beat. The only problem I have with the horn is that the typical problem notes for an F tuba are also on this horn. In this case, low C and B require extra attention. The mouthpipe receiver on mine is quite small and I recently purchase a Doug Elliott mouthpiece that has a shank that fits better into the receiver. This helped the response of the problem notes a little bit but not a lot.

Overall, I'd say this is a great horn for certain situations. I wouldn't recommend this horn as a main instrument because I don't feel it is very versatile. As cheap as they are, if you get a good one it is nice to have around for occasional usage.
